My mission is to achieve a lower guest bounce rate (aka more guests stick around on survival)
My way of achieving that is:

- Re-doing the 20 something page help book into a small 3 page book which contains the essentials (get the core facts to them without boring them). The big book will be available as an optional read in /gui once we implement this
- Reduce first time offender punishments for non-griefing guests
- Reward guests for staying on the server (Dpa has an idea on how to do that, I am running it past the Manager+ team atm). Basically give them some empbucks for playing a certan amount of hours.
- Reduce Member rank requirements if guests have a forum account


I need feedback on these actions that we are currently debating on, and possibly more actions you think we should take.
